Abstract

Applicants have devised a highly effective, convenient, and expeditious genetic transformation system for filamentous fungi, such as. The preferred method uses an-mediated transformation protocol. The critical features of this protocol include co-cultivation of the bacterium with fruit body tissue instead of spores. In a preferred embodiment, even higher transformation efficiencies were observed with the use of a homologous promoter in the polynucleotide expression construct in order to drive gene expression.
